Assertion: In a marine aquatic ecosystem, the biomass of phytoplanktons (producers) at any given time, is lower than the biomass of zooplanktons (primary consumers).
Reason: Phytoplanktons are consumed almost as rapidly as they are formed and thus have shorter life spans.

Text Solution

Verified by Experts

The correct Answer is:
A

In a marine aquatic ecosystem, the biomass of phytoplanktons (producers) is smaller than that of zooplanktons (primary consumers) and the biomass of zooplanktons is smaller than that of secondary consumers. This results in the inverted pyramid of biomass in an aquatic ecosystem. This shape is the consequence of the very short life spans of phytoplanktons, which are consumed almost as rapidly as they are formed.

Food chains are very important for the survival of most species. When only one element is removed from the food chain it can result in extinction of a species in some cases. The foundation of the food chain consists of primary producers Primary producers, or autotrophs, can use either solar energy or chemical energy to create complex organic compounds, whereas species at higher trophic levels cannot and so must consume producers or other life that itself consumes producers. Because the sun's light is necessary for photosynthesis, most life could not exist if the sun disappeared. Even so, it has recently been discovered that there are some forms of life, chemotrophs, that appear to gain all their metabolic energy from chemosythesis driven by hydrothermal vents, thus showing that some life may not require solar energy to thrive.
